1. Arum’s Ambition: Teofimo vs. Haney on the Horizon

Top Rank promoter Bob Arum has expressed his desire to set up a fight between Teofimo Lopez and Devin Haney, contingent on Haney vacating his WBC light welterweight title. This potential matchup comes amidst uncertainty about Haney’s willingness to defend his title against his mandatory challenger, Sandor Martin.

2. Purse Bid Controversy: Haney’s Hesitation

Arum’s Top Rank recently won the purse bid for the Haney vs. Martin fight with a $2.42 million bid. However, Haney’s reluctance to engage in this bout has become evident, with the fighter expressing dissatisfaction and making snide remarks about Matchroom’s lack of interest in bidding for the fight.

3. The Temptation of 147: Haney’s Potential Move

Haney’s interest seemed piqued when Mario Barrios was upgraded to the full WBC welterweight champion. This has led to speculation that Haney might vacate his 140-lb title to move up to 147 lbs and challenge Barrios for his belt, potentially avoiding the mandatory defense against Martin.

4. The Spoiled Fighter Syndrome

There’s a growing sentiment among fans and analysts that Haney may be falling into the “spoiled fighter” trap. After securing a significant payday against Ryan Garcia on April 20th, Haney might now be expecting all his fights to offer similarly lucrative rewards. This mindset can lead to fighters sitting out, waiting for big money fights, which ultimately erodes their skills and popularity.

5. Arum’s Strategy: Setting Up a Blockbuster

“If we can arrange a Teofimo – Haney fight, which is an interesting fight, then we’ll try to do that,” Arum told Fighthype. Arum sees a potential Haney vs. Lopez fight as an exciting and marketable event, especially if the Sandor Martin fight doesn’t come to fruition.

6. Haney’s Dilemma: Risk vs. Reward

A fight against Teofimo Lopez poses significant risks for Haney, especially given Lopez’s controversial wins over Jamaine Ortiz and Sandor Martin. Both fighters appeared to dominate Lopez but ended up losing on the judges’ scorecards. Haney must consider the possibility of similar treatment if the fight is staged in New York, a venue where Lopez has historically received favorable decisions.

7. The Judging Controversy: A Recurring Issue

The boxing world has seen several contentious decisions involving Lopez, including his win over Vasily Lomachenko. This pattern of questionable judging raises concerns for Haney, who must weigh the potential for an unfair outcome if he takes on Lopez.

8. Arum’s Respect for Haney’s Decision

“Everybody has to make their own choices. As long as they’re honest about it and don’t try to blame and cast aspersions on other people. Devin is a nice young man and he’s never done that,” said Arum, emphasizing his respect for Haney’s autonomy in deciding whether to fight Martin or pursue other opportunities.
